Ayssa Galloway

Ayssa Galloway - formerly Garcia - returned to McMurry University as the assistant volleyball coach prior to the 2017 season. Galloway was a standout libero for the War Hawks program for the 2012 and 2013 seasons.
 
Gallwoay, as a college freshman, helped lead the McMurry program to the National Christian College Athletic Association (NCCAA) national championship in 2012.  McM won NCCAA regional titles both of her years, as well.
 
At McM, she set the school record for digs in each of her seasons, garnering 623 as a freshman and 764 as a sophomore. Her 1,387 digs – in just two seasons – ranks No. 2 on McMurry’s career list.
 
She transferred to Tarleton State University her final two collegiate seasons, where she was a part of TSU’s first-ever Lone Star Conference tournament championship – and NCAA playoff team - in 2014, as well as LSC regular season title team in 2015.
 
She graduated from Tarleton State in 2016.
 
After graduation, Galloway began coaching with the Abilene Stars Volleyball Club.
 
Galloway is a native of San Antonio, Texas where she was a graduate of Claudia Taylor Johnson High School (2012). As a prep, Galloway earned a pair of all-district honors and was all-state honorable mention as a senior.

She is married to former McMurry and West Texas A&M football player William Galloway. The couple wed on January 5, 2018. William is a college campus minister at McMurry, working for Grace Point Church.
